python读取列表并存为excel文件一列
时间: 2023-04-09 17:03:36 浏览: 81
可以使用pandas库来读取列表并存为excel文件一列。具体代码如下:
```python
import pandas as pd
my_list = [1, 2, 3, 4, 5]
df = pd.DataFrame(my_list, columns=['列名'])
df.to_excel('文件名.xlsx', index=False)
```
其中,my_list是要存储的列表,'列名'是要存储的列名,'文件名.xlsx'是要保存的文件名。
相关问题
python读取列表并存为txt文件一列
可以使用Python的文件操作函数将列表中的元素逐行写入txt文件中。具体实现方法如下:
```python
# 定义列表
my_list = ['apple', 'banana', 'orange', 'pear']
# 打开文件
with open('my_file.txt', 'w') as f:
# 遍历列表,逐行写入文件
for item in my_list:
f.write(item + '\n')
```
以上代码将列表`my_list`中的元素逐行写入名为`my_file.txt`的文件中。其中,`with open('my_file.txt', 'w') as f:`语句打开文件并创建文件对象,`for item in my_list:`语句遍历列表中的元素,`f.write(item + '\n')`语句将元素写入文件并换行。
python读取excel文件一列
以下是使用Python读取Excel文件中一列数据的方法:
```python
import xlrd
# 打开Excel文件
workbook = xlrd.open_workbook('example.xlsx')
# 选择第一个工作表
worksheet = workbook.sheet_by_index(0)
# 获取第一列数据
column_data = worksheet.col_values(0)
# 输出第一列数据
print(column_data)
```
在上述代码中,我们使用了`xlrd`库来读取Excel文件。首先,我们打开Excel文件并选择第一个工作表。然后,我们使用`col_values()`方法获取第一列数据,并将其存储在`column_data`变量中。最后,我们输出`column_data`变量的值,即Excel文件中第一列的数据。